Understanding the Basics of the Chicken Road Crash Game
At its core, the chicken road game is remarkably straightforward. A chicken diligently strides along a path comprised of multiple lines, and with each step, the multiplier value increases. The objective is simple: cash out before the chicken inevitably…well, meets an unfortunate end. This ending occurs when the chicken collides with obstacles, halting the multiplier and resulting in a loss of the wager. The appeal lies in this delicate balance between greed and caution, as players must decide when to secure their winnings versus pushing their luck for potentially larger rewards.

Understanding the Return to Player (RTP)
A crucial factor in any casino game is the Return to Player (RTP) percentage. This represents the theoretical amount of wagered money that is returned to players over a long period. The chicken road game boasts an impressively high RTP of 98%. This means that, on average, 98% of all money wagered on the game is paid back to players. However, it’s vital to remember that RTP is a long-term average and doesn’t guarantee individual session results. Short-term variance can lead to both significant wins and losses.

The Psychology of Crash Games
Crash games, including the chicken road game, heavily rely on psychological factors. The increasing multiplier creates a sense of urgency and excitement, leading players to succumb to the “near-miss effect”—the belief that past near-losses increase their chances of future wins. This is a fallacy. Each round is entirely independent, and past results have no bearing on future outcomes. Successful players are able to remain disciplined, stick to their predetermined cash-out strategy, and avoid emotional betting. Controlling your emotions is paramount.
